After nearly a year of trailing behind Lowe's, Home Depot's comparable store sales have caught up with its rival in the latest quarter, according to CNBC. This development could signal a narrowing performance gap and may influence relative stock performance between the two home improvement retailers.

CNBC reported that it took nearly a year for Home Depot's comparable store sales (comps) to finally match those of Lowe's, with the milestone occurring in the most recent quarter. While the source did not provide specific numerical data, the parity in comps may reflect shifts in consumer spending patterns, operational adjustments, or regional demand trends. Historically, Lowe's had outperformed Home Depot on this key metric, but the current quarter suggests a possible reversal or stabilization. The catch-up could be attributed to factors such as improved inventory management, targeted promotions, or a recovery in DIY demand at Home Depot. Both retailers have faced a challenging housing market and higher interest rates, which have dampened big-ticket purchases. However, the recent quarterly results indicate that Home Depot may be gaining traction in attracting customers, particularly in categories where Lowe's had previously held an edge. Key takeaways from this development include the potential for Home Depot's stock to narrow the valuation gap with Lowe's. If comparable sales continue to track closely, investor sentiment could shift toward Home Depot as a more compelling relative value. The home improvement sector overall may benefit from steady demand as homeowners focus on maintenance and smaller projects rather than large renovations. Market observers might interpret this as a sign that Home Depot's strategic initiatives—such as enhanced e-commerce capabilities or pro-focused services—are beginning to yield results. However, sustainability remains uncertain, and future quarters will be critical to confirm whether the comps parity is temporary or part of a longer-term trend. The broader economic environment, including inflation and interest rate expectations, will likely influence both retailers' performance. From an investment perspective, the catching-up of Home Depot's comps could imply a more balanced competitive landscape. Investors may view this as a potential catalyst for Home Depot's shares, though caution is warranted. The source did not provide forward-looking guidance, and no specific analyst recommendations were cited. The development may also prompt a reassessment of relative valuations between the two companies. If Home Depot maintains its comps momentum, its stock could outperform historically lagging expectations. However, risks such as a slowdown in housing turnover or a shift in consumer spending away from home improvement could affect both retailers.
